WebDomestic Cat Karyotype The domestic cat chromosomal complement is 2N = 38 (N = 19) with 18 autosomes and the XY sex chromosomes (XX is female, XY is male). WebDiploid and stable karyotypes are associated with health and fitness in animals. By contrast, whole-genome duplications—doublings of the entire complement of chromosomes—are linked to genetic instability and frequently found in human cancers. A picture of all 46chromosomes in their pairs is called a karyotype. A normal female karyotype is written 46, XX, and a normal male karyotype is written 46, XY.
